Breaking: Williams sisters knocked out by Aussie Joint and Chan

Australian Maya Joint and doubles partner Hao-Ching Chan have triumphed over Serena and Venus Williams in the US Open women's doubles first round.

Hao-Ching Chan (right) of Chinese Taipei and Maya Joint (left) of Australia in action against Serena Williams of the United States and Venus Williams of the United States in the first round of doubles on Day 6 of the US Open at USTA Billie Jean King National Tennis Center on September 04, 2026 in New York City ( Getty Images: Robert Prange )

Australian Maya Joint has again spoiled the part for the legendary Williams sisters, teaming up with Hao-Ching Chan to knock Serena and Venus out of the first round of the US Open women's doubles.

In front of a packed and passionate crowd at Arthur Ashe Stadium, Joint and Chan came from 0-5 down in the deciding 10-point tiebreaker to down the legendary sisters 6-3, 6-7 (6/8), 7-6 (10/7).

This is the second consecutive grand slam that Joint has played spoiler, knocking Serena out in the first round of the Wimbledon ladies singles on Centre Court.
